ketilh Posted January 12, 2012 Share Posted January 12, 2012 Hello. We've just started using iReport, and all three of us are experiencing the same problem. It is unreasonably slow on selecting a report element. The time for the properties to fill can be 5-10 seconds. Other cases seem to respond in a more timely fashion, but dragging items from the palette is sometimes also very slow. The same computers run eclipse quite a bit faster. They are win7 64 bit boxes accessed by remote desktop to proxmox virtualizations. I've tried earlyer versions of iReport running virtualbox locally and have not encountered these problems. svenn Posted January 12, 2012 Share Posted January 12, 2012 It has something to do with how the newer version of iReport based on the NetBeans platform behaves. It seems to get slower and slower as you continue to use it until it gets to the point where it is unusable. Some have suggested increasing the memory available to the application but I tried that and it did not make a difference.What I end up doing was uninstalling and reinstalling iReport. It zipped right along after. Not the best solution. Hopefully JasperSoft will address this issue.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
